The franchise remains mostly faithful to its established formula, which is comforting for veterans like myself who've invested hundreds of hours across previous versions. The core mechanics—exploring intricate temple networks, deciphering glyph-based puzzles, navigating treacherous jungle environments—all remain beautifully intact. But there's one addition that's completely transformed my approach: Custom Game Entry Conditions. This isn't just another difficulty setting or cosmetic toggle. This is a paradigm shift in how we engage with historical simulation games. Essentially, it lets you simulate games automatically until specific conditions are met, at which point you seamlessly take control. I've been using this feature for about three weeks now, and I can confidently say it's reduced my unnecessary gameplay time by approximately 40% while simultaneously increasing my engagement quality.

What truly fascinates me about this system is the situation-importance slider, which ranges from low to very high. This isn't just a simple filter—it's an intelligent gatekeeper that understands narrative tension. When I set it to "very high," the system only hands me control during moments of extreme consequence. I remember one session where the game ran autonomously for nearly 45 minutes before suddenly transitioning me into control right as my expedition team discovered a hidden chamber while simultaneously triggering an ancient trap mechanism. The tension was palpable, and I found myself making decisions with genuine weight behind them. Contrast this with setting the slider to "low," where I found myself taking over during relatively mundane moments like resource gathering or basic navigation. The beauty is in how this system respects different playstyles—whether you're a completionist who wants to experience everything or someone like me who prefers curating only the most dramatic moments.

From my professional perspective as someone who regularly analyzes interactive systems, the implementation here is remarkably sophisticated. The algorithm appears to evaluate multiple variables simultaneously—player progression, narrative arc, resource availability, and potential consequence magnitude—to determine what constitutes a "critical situation." I've noticed it tends to prioritize transitions during what narrative theorists would call "liminal moments," those points where the story could branch in significantly different directions. In my testing, setting the importance slider to "high" resulted in approximately 68% of transition moments occurring during what I'd classify as narratively significant events, compared to just 22% at the "low" setting. These numbers might not be perfect—my sample size was limited to about 80 hours of gameplay—but they demonstrate the feature's substantive impact on experience curation.
